რა არის git pre მიღების hook?
რა არის git pre მიღების hook?

ვიდეო: რა არის git pre მიღების hook?

ვიდეო: რა არის git pre მიღების hook?
ვიდეო: Git pre-commit hook in 45 seconds! #Shorts 2024, მარტი
Anonim

წინასწარი - მიღება

ეს კაკალი მოწოდებულია გიტ - მიღება -შეფუთვა[1] როდესაც ის რეაგირებს გიტ დააყენებს და განაახლებს მითითებებს მის საცავში. დისტანციურ საცავზე refs-ების განახლების დაწყებამდე, წინასწარი - კაკლის მიღება მოწოდებულია. მისი გასვლის სტატუსი განსაზღვრავს განახლების წარმატებას ან წარუმატებლობას.

ანალოგიურად, შეგიძლიათ იკითხოთ, რა არის წინასწარი მიღების კაკალი?

წინასწარი - კაკვების მიღება არის სკრიპტები, რომლებიც მუშაობს GitHub Enterprise Server მოწყობილობაზე, რომლებიც შეგიძლიათ გამოიყენოთ ხარისხის შემოწმების განსახორციელებლად.

უფრო მეტიც, რატომ იყენებდით წინასწარ მიღებულ კველს თქვენს დისტანციურ საცავში? წინასწარი - კაკვების მიღება განახორციელოს წვლილი შეტანის წესების შესრულებამდე, სანამ ვალდებულებები შეიძლება აიძულოს ა საცავი . წინასწარი - კაკვების მიღება გაუშვით ტესტები კოდზე, რომელიც აიძულა a საცავი რათა უზრუნველყოს შენატანების დაკმაყოფილება საცავი ან ორგანიზაციის პოლიტიკა. თუ ჩაიდინოს შინაარსი გაივლის ტესტებს, ბიძგი მიიღება მასში საცავი.

მეორეც, რა არის git pre commit hook?

Git კაკვები არის სკრიპტები, რომლებიც გიტ ახორციელებს მოვლენების წინ ან შემდეგ, როგორიცაა: ჩაიდინოს , ბიძგი და მიიღეთ. Git კაკვები არის ჩაშენებული ფუნქცია - არაფრის ჩამოტვირთვა არ არის საჭირო. Git კაკვები იმართება ადგილობრივად. წინასწარი - ჩაიდინოს : Შეამოწმე ჩაიდინოს შეტყობინება ორთოგრაფიული შეცდომებისთვის.

როგორ აწყობთ წინასწარ ჩაბარებას?

შექმნა ა წინასწარი - ჩაიდინოს hook შეინახეთ ფაილი და გამოდით რედაქტორიდან. შეინახეთ ცვლილებები. ამ ეტაპზე შეგიძლიათ ტესტირება დასძინა დაბეჭდეთ განცხადებები ან იმპორტი PDB პითონის სკრიპტში. შეცვალეთ ფაილები და სცადეთ მათი ჩადენა კაკალი ავრცელებს შემდეგ შეტყობინებას და წყვეტს ჩადენას.

გირჩევთ: